 Founders Room Rejuvination

Wanda's Founders Room is under going a minor rejuvenation (cheaper than a renovation). The surf club has contracted a builder and a crack team of demolition experts both old and new (see below). 

Gyprock has lined the walls and roof, new down lights, speakers and the ladies entrance moved to a more discreet position. The final touches are expected to put together in the coming weeks.

 Wanda Surf Lifesaving Club

Wanda was established in 1946 after the Second World War by a group of men who banded together, as they did in warfare, to do another job. The colours of Army red, Air Force blue, and Navy blue were adopted as the club colours.

Since this time, the club has grown in size to its current membership of over 900 male and female members, ranging in age from five year old Nippers to the original Founding Members.

The primary objective of the club is to patrol the beach in an effort to ensure the safety of the surfing public. Wanda is actively involved in the competition arena, with excellent performances at State and National Competitions. A number of social activities are organised throughout the year to bring together members from all sections of the club.
